`
xpenxpen
  • 浏览: 704221 次
  • 性别: Icon_minigender_1
  • 来自: 上海
社区版块
存档分类
最新评论
文章列表
在以jax-ws的方式使用axis2 时 tomcat 抛出如下错误 {java.lang.ClassNotFoundException: com.sun.tools.ws.spi.WSToolsObjectFactory} 原因:   tomcat找不到jdk的tools.jar 解决办法:   找到jdk的安装目录下的lib目录,把lib目录下的tools.jar 拷贝到tomcat的lib目录下即可
1.到http://www.eclipse.org/downloads/下载eclipse,注意一定要下载eclipse classic,只有这个才带源代码的,其他比如Eclipse IDE for Java EE Developers, Eclipse IDE for Java Developers都是不带源码的。 2.1 打开eclipse,File->Import..,选择Plug-in development下面的Plug-ins and Fragments. Next 2.2 出现Import Plug-ins and Fragments对话框,Import As 选择P ...

梅森旋转算法

    梅森旋转算法(Mersenne twister) 是一个伪随机数发生算法。由。Makoto Matsumoto(松本真) 和Takuji Nishimura(西村拓士)在1997年开发的,基于有限二进制字段上的矩阵线性递归field F_{2}。 可以快速产生高质量的伪随机数, 修正了古典随机数发生算法的很多缺陷。     梅森旋转算法这个名字来自周期长度取自梅森素数的这样一个事实。这个算法通常使用两个相近的变体,不同之处在于使用了不同的梅森素数。一个更新的和更常用的是MT19937, 32位字长。 还有一个变种是64位版的MT19937-64。 对于一个k位的长度,Mersenne ...
今天启动Tomcat启动不了,报以下错: org.apache.catalina.core.StandardContext startInternal SEVERE: Error listenerStart org.apache.catalina.core.StandardContext startInternal SEVERE: Context [/******] startup failed due to previous errors 网上找了N多文章,都没有切中要害。 后来在国外网站上搜到一个方法 http://grails.1312388.n4.nabble.com/Deploym ...
原文见http://crazier9527.iteye.com/blog/408610,本文仅是引用。 启动psftp.exe,和 Putty 一样是全字符界面。相对于 shell 繁多的命令,上传和下载使用的命令屈指可数,将用到的命令列在下面:     open calpico.dreamhost.com 用于连接远程 linux 服务器,其中 calpico.dreamhost.com 替换为您自己的地址。     cd public_html/wp-content/ 用于切换远程 Linux 服务器上的目录,其中 public_html/wp-contnt 替换为您自己实际的路径。 ...
1.Dummy 对象被四处传递,但是从不被真正使用。通常他们只是用来填充参数列表。 2.Fake 有实际可工作的实现,但是通常有一些缺点导致不适合用于产品(基于内存的数据库就是一个好例子)。 3.Stub 在测试过程中产生的调用提供预备好的应答,通常不应答计划之外的任何事。stubs可能记录关于调用的信息,比如 邮件网关的stub 会记录它发送的消息,或者可能仅仅是发送了多少信息。 4.Mock 预先计划好的对象,带有各种期待,他们组成了一个关于他们期待接受的调用的详细说明。
2014/08/28更新 在github上fork了一个mybatis源码中文注释版,方便大家学习。     最近研读了一下mybatis3的源码,这个框架本身相对其他框架还是比较简单的。因为他上手快,一般没接触过的童鞋一天之内看看官方那个中文文档就能上手。现在读源码,觉得代码也比较清晰,虽然注释很少,但代码都是自解释的。 1.mybatis中的设计模式 工厂模式SqlSessionFactory/ObjectFactory/MapperProxyFactory 建造模式SqlSessionFactoryBuilder/XMLConfigBuilder/XMLMapperBuilder/X ...
参考自 http://www.sencha.com/learn/grid-faq, How to select text in the grid (with the mouse) so that it can be copied to the clipboard First, add an extra CSS rule: <style type="text/css"> .x-selectable, .x-selectable * { -moz-user-select: text!important; ...
代码和博客都是用了原作者的,具体请参见作者的原文: http://www.rahulsingla.com/blog/2010/03/cross-browser-approach-to-copy-content-to-clipboard-with-javascript http://www.rahulsingla.com/blog/2010/03/extjs-copy-gridpanel-content-to-clipboard http://www.rahulsingla.com/blog/2010/10/extjs-copying-gridpanel-single-row-data-to-cl ...

RabbitMQ安装

    博客分类:
  • MQ
1.下载并安装erlang,http://www.erlang.org/download.html,最新版是R15B01(5.9.1)。由于我机器是64位的Win7,所以找到otp_win64_R15B01.exe下载并安装。 2.配置环境变量 增加一个系统环境变量ERLANG_HOME配置为C:\Program Files\erl5.9.1 3.下载RabbitMQ,最新版是2.8.1,http://www.rabbitmq.com/releases/rabbitmq-server/v2.8.1/rabbitmq-server-windows-2.8.1.zip。 4.解压RabbitM ...
原文转自 http://www.cnblogs.com/sunwangji/archive/2006/08/21/482341.html,适当做了修改 在提到上述的概念之前,首先想说说javascript中函数的隐含参数:arguments Arguments 该对象代表正在执行的函数和调用它的函数的参数。 [function.]arguments[n] 参数 function :选项。当前正在执行的 Function 对象的名字。 n :选项。要传递给 Function 对象的从0开始的参数值索引。 说明 Arguments是进行函数调用时,除了指定的参数外,还另外创建的一个 ...
jpcap是用来监控网络封包的java实现API。 有2个版本jpcap,网址是 http://www.netresearch.ics.uci.edu/kfujii/Jpcap/doc/index.html http://jpcap.sourceforge.net/ 他们是完全不同的版本,前者貌似新一点,还在维护中。后者04年以后就没更新了。 1.因为他们是通过jni调用本地winpcap的,所以先得安装winpcap,到http://www.winpcap.org/下载最新的winpcap4.12,安装,记得有个选项是启动计算机时启动监控服务要打上勾,然后重启计算机。 2.1先说http: ...
第一个bug,gateway不能自动注入进Controller! 原因是ibatis插件没有把欲注入的gateway首字母改成小写 可修改C:\Documents and Settings\XX\.grails\2.0.0\projects\XX\plugins\ibatis-1.3.1\ IbatisGrailsPlugin.groovy 把 "${a.shortName}"(a.clazz) { bean -> 改为 def shortName = a.shortName[0].toLowerCase() + a.shortName[1..-1]; ...
我们想监控SQL执行的效率,打出执行时间。一般Spring项目都是用AOP拦截,然后计算方法开始结束时间,再减一下,就得到执行花的时间了。那Grails里更简单,不用自己写代码,其实用的是Spring的PerformanceMonitorInterceptor。 修改grails-app\conf\spring\resources.groovy beans = { xmlns aop:"http://www.springframework.org/schema/aop" aop { config("proxy-target-class" ...
SQL很简单,查询一个表在日期区间内的记录条数。 原来是这么写的 SELECT COUNT(1) FROM TABLE_X A WHERE 1 = 1 AND TO_CHAR(A.starttime, 'YYYYMMDDHH24MISS') >= '20010101121212' AND TO_CHAR(A.endtime, 'YYYYMMDDHH24MISS') <= '20130101121212' 这张表1000万级数据,查询count用了15秒。 改成下面这样 SELECT COUNT(1) FROM TABLE_X A WHERE 1 = 1 ...
Global site tag (gtag.js) - Google Analytics